A solo online seller asked Alibaba’s AI, Accio, to remake his old best-selling flashlight.
In one chat, it suggested simple tweaks.
Smaller body.
A bit dimmer.
Battery-powered.
Then it surfaced a factory in Ningbo, China.
The estimated unit cost dropped from $17 to about $2.50.
Weeks of back-and-forth became days.

↓ A simple guardrail framework before you trust any sourcing AI.
↳ Ask for full supplier transparency.
• Who is the factory.
• Who is the broker.
• What data trained the recommendations.
↳ Lock down security.
• What product files get stored.
• Who can access your specs.
↳ Set clear data guardrails.
• What the tool can retain.
• What must be deleted.
